What are the potential health effects of consuming MSG?

Consuming MSG may cause symptoms like headaches, nausea, and chest pain in some people, known as "Chinese restaurant syndrome." However, scientific research has not conclusively proven a direct link between MSG and these symptoms. It is important to note that MSG is generally recognized as safe by the FDA when consumed in moderate amounts.


Which philosophy is most closely associated with the development of the Chinese civil service system?

Confucianism is most closely associated with the development of the Chinese civil service system. Confucian principles emphasizing meritocracy, education, and moral virtue were key elements in determining eligibility for government positions.


What Chinese philosophy was based on the teachings of Laozi?

Daoism, also known as Taoism, is the Chinese philosophy based on the teachings of Laozi. It emphasizes living in harmony with the Dao (the Way) and encourages individuals to embrace simplicity, spontaneity, and compassion in order to achieve balance and harmony in life.

What is the role of the Chinese dragon?

In ancient Chinese mythology, Chinese Dragons were associated with bringing rain and good harvest.

What was the cause of the tainted pet food in the March 2007 recall?

Contaminated wheat gluten from Chinese importer Chemnutra Inc.
